Why hash_get_all needs a policy

The tool performs a read-only retrieval operation ('get all fields and values'). It accesses data without creating, modifying, or destructively removing anything. Even in the context of an SNS/SQS server, this appears to be a data query/inspection function. Blast radius is minimal—worst case, unintended information disclosure of non-sensitive metadata.

From the tool's definition Tool description: "Get all fields and values from hash." This retrieves data from a hash structure without modifying or deleting it. No side effects indicated.

Can I rate-limit hash_get_all? +

Yes. Add a rate_limit block to the hash_get_all rule in your PolicyLayer policy. For example, setting max: 10 and window: 60 limits the tool to 10 calls per minute. Rate limits are tracked per agent session and reset automatically.

How do I block hash_get_all completely? +

Set action: deny in the PolicyLayer policy for hash_get_all. The AI agent will receive a policy violation error and cannot call the tool. You can also include a reason field to explain why the tool is blocked.
